!Electrical Connection
•See technical data of connected values.
•Check whether the voltage shown on the rating
plate corresponds to that of the power source.
Note:
If you are using an extension cable, it
should always be completely unwound from the
cabledrumandhaveasufficientcross-sectional
area: 10 m = 1.5 mm², 30m = 2.5 mm²

#Water Connection with coupling
•See technical data for connected values.
•Screwthecouplingontothewaterconnectionof
the appliance.
•Connect a water supply hose (not supplied) to
the appliance and the water pipe.
Suction
Observethefollowingifyouaredrawingwaterfrom
an open container:
1.Unscrewthecouplingfromthewaterconnection
of the appliance, and attach a suction hose
with filter (order no. 4.440-238) directly to the
appliance.
2.Allow the pump to operate without the high-
pressure hose until water appears at the high-
pressure outlet without any more bubbles.
3.Then re-attach the high-pressure hose.
Note:
Dirt in the feed water could lead to the ap-
pliance being damaged.To avoid this risk, we re-
commend fitting a filter. A suitable filter with 3/4"
connectionisavailableunderOrderNo.6.414-389.

%Trigger Gun with safety ratchet (A)
and high-pressure hose
•Connect the high-pressure hose to the high-
pressure outlet.
Note:
The safety ratchet does not lock the lever
of the gun during operation but only prevents it
from opening unintentionally.
&&
&&
&Spray lance with double nozzle
•Pushthespray lance against the spring into the
bayonet connector of the gun, and then rotate it
through 90° until it clicks into place.
•You can choose between 2 different types of
spray by rotating the front protective device on
the spray lance:
High-pressure flat spray
for large surface dirt.
Low-pressure flat spray
for cleaning with detergent
Note:
Only rotate the front protective device on
the spray lance when the gun is closed.
